Is Manila Bbq & Seafood Grill clean?
Manila Bbq & Seafood Grill is currently Grade C from Southern Nevada Health District (SNHD), from an inspection on May 28, 2026. Inspectors wrote up 4 critical violations — the kind most directly linked to foodborne illness. On Cooked's ladder that reads cooked 🪳.

How Las Vegas grades restaurants
The Southern Nevada Health District grades on demerits, and here more is worse: roughly 0–10 demerits earns an A, 11–20 a B, and 21 or more a C. Serious problems can skip the ladder entirely — an imminent health hazard gets the permit suspended and the kitchen shut on the spot, which shows up as a closure rather than a letter. SNHD covers all of Clark County, so Henderson, North Las Vegas and the unincorporated Strip all run the same scheme. Cooked reads A as clean, B as mid, C or a closure as cooked.
